259  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: Tiền giấy so với tiền kỹ thuật số on: April 12, 2021, 03:12:38 PM
The advantage of banknotes is that it is direct immediately with a variety of denominations for all types of goods and does not cost anything to pay. For items with small denominations, it is difficult to return the change and normally if shopping in the store, the employee will pay you some candy worth the extra money they cannot pay. with paper money. Banknotes have value in existence and anonymity. The holder of the banknote has immediate and unaffected power over the fiat money in the bank account. Banknotes need to be properly stored and they will lose value if you damage them.
For large transactions up to tens of millions of dollars, billions of dollars in cash transactions will be more difficult to execute.

Cryptocurrencies can pay for any item of value up to billions of dollars. Cryptocurrencies can be as small as a few digits after the decimal. Cryptocurrencies may or may not be anonymous depending on the currency you use. Appropriate electronic equipment is required for use and storage. Cryptocurrency transactions will incur a certain cost. Cryptocurrencies are secured on the blockchain so there will be no fraudulent operations.
